RSA Sign Using Private Key from .pfx/.p12 to Base64 Signature

Demonstrates how to RSA sign something using a private key loaded from a .pfx/.p12. The RSA signature is returned in Base64 encoded format.Chilkat Xbase++ Downloads
LOCAL nSuccess
LOCAL oRsa
LOCAL oPfx
LOCAL oPrivKey
LOCAL cStrData
LOCAL cBase64Sig
nSuccess := 0
// This example assumes the Chilkat API to have been previously unlocked.
// See Global Unlock Sample for sample code.
oRsa := CreateObject("Chilkat.Rsa")
// Load the .pfx/.p12
oPfx := CreateObject("Chilkat.Pfx")
nSuccess := oPfx:LoadPfxFile("qa_data/pfx/myKey.p12", "myPassword")
IF (nSuccess == 0)
? oPfx:LastErrorText
oRsa:destroy()
oPfx:destroy()
RETURN
ENDIF
// Get the default private key.
oPrivKey := CreateObject("Chilkat.PrivateKey")
nSuccess := oPfx:PrivateKeyAt(0, oPrivKey)
IF (nSuccess == 0)
? oPfx:LastErrorText
oRsa:destroy()
oPfx:destroy()
oPrivKey:destroy()
RETURN
ENDIF
// Import the private key into the RSA component:
nSuccess := oRsa:UsePrivateKey(oPrivKey)
IF (nSuccess == 0)
? oRsa:LastErrorText
oRsa:destroy()
oPfx:destroy()
oPrivKey:destroy()
RETURN
ENDIF
// Get the signature in base64
oRsa:EncodingMode := "base64"
cStrData := "This is the string to be signed."
// Sign the string using the sha256 hash algorithm.
// Other valid choices are "sha384", "sha512", "sha-1", "md2" and "md5".
cBase64Sig := oRsa:SignStringENC(cStrData, "sha256")
? cBase64Sig
? "Success!"
oRsa:destroy()
oPfx:destroy()
oPrivKey:destroy()
